Top Android App Testing Services for Agile Development

Written by TestersHUB  »  Updated on: December 24th, 2024

In today’s fast-paced world of mobile app development, ensuring that an Android app performs optimally is crucial. As more businesses shift to agile development practices, it becomes even more important to have a solid Android app testing strategy in place. With the need for continuous updates and rapid iterations, reliable testing tools and services are critical to meeting high-quality standards. From manual testing to automation test app Android solutions, various testing methodologies ensure the app’s functionality, usability, and performance. In this blog, we will explore some of the most effective android app testing services that empower agile development teams to deliver bug-free, high-performing apps.


1. Automation Testing for Android Apps

One of the most efficient ways to perform comprehensive android application automation is through automation testing for Android apps. Using automation testing tools like Appium, Espresso, and Selenium, developers can automate repetitive test cases, drastically reducing testing time. Automated tests also ensure consistency, as the same tests are executed in the same manner every time, making it easier to catch bugs early in the development cycle.


Appium app testing is one of the leading choices for automation. It supports multiple programming languages, allowing developers to write tests in their preferred language. This cross-platform support, coupled with its ability to integrate with different test frameworks, makes Appium an ideal tool for android app automation testing.


2. Real Device Testing Android

While emulators and simulators are valuable tools, testing on real devices is essential to catch issues that may arise only in real-world usage scenarios. Test Android app on real devices ensures the app performs well across different hardware configurations, screen sizes, and OS versions. Many testing services offer access to a wide range of physical devices, allowing developers to perform tests in various environments without needing to own multiple devices.


This service is especially crucial for applications with complex UI elements or specific hardware requirements, where android UI testing on real devices ensures that the app performs seamlessly across all possible scenarios.


3. Beta Testing on Google Play

Google Play beta testing is a critical part of ensuring an app is ready for public release. By using beta testing on Google Play, developers can push the app to a limited audience before its official release. This allows users to provide feedback on usability, functionality, and performance. It also helps identify potential bugs that might not have been caught during initial testing phases. Google Play's built-in beta testing feature enables developers to easily distribute the app to testers, monitor issues, and make improvements based on real-user feedback.


4. Android App Manual Testing

While automation tools are incredibly powerful, manual testing still plays an important role in app testing. Android app manual testing focuses on areas where human insight is needed, such as user interface design, usability, and user experience. Manual testing is particularly useful for identifying non-technical issues, like inconsistencies in design or navigation, that automated tools may miss.


Manual testing is also essential during the early stages of development when automated tests are not yet in place. It allows developers to quickly identify and fix issues before automation comes into play.


5. Testing Android Apps for Compatibility

Compatibility testing ensures your app works across various devices and Android versions. Automation test Android services help verify compatibility across a wide range of Android devices, but testing across multiple versions of Android OS is essential to ensure maximum reach. Moreover, automation testing tools for Android mobile applications can simulate multiple user environments, offering insights into how the app behaves on different networks, device conditions, and other external factors.


Conclusion

As Android development continues to evolve, android app testing services will play a central role in delivering high-quality, bug-free apps. From automation test app Android solutions like Appium and Espresso to real device testing Android, a multi-faceted testing approach is essential for agile development teams. Additionally, Google Play beta testing offers an invaluable real-world testing phase, while manual testing provides human insights into user experience. By leveraging these services, businesses can ensure their Android apps meet the highest standards of performance, security, and user satisfaction, resulting in greater success on the Google Play Store.


Disclaimer:

We do not claim ownership of any content, links or images featured on this post unless explicitly stated. If you believe any content or images infringes on your copyright, please contact us immediately for removal ([email protected]). Please note that content published under our account may be sponsored or contributed by guest authors. We assume no responsibility for the accuracy or originality of such content. We hold no responsibilty of content and images published as ours is a publishers platform. Mail us for any query and we will remove that content/image immediately.